
Itching (also called pruritus) is a common issue in cats and can range from mild scratching to constant grooming that leads to skin damage. While occasional itching is normal, persistent or intense itching is usually a sign of an underlying problem.
If your cat seems uncomfortable, is overgrooming, or is causing damage to their skin, it’s important to take a closer look.
